lonnie 05-17-2008 11:06 PM

MX4000/MDA4000 AM/FM tuner/CD transport. Power guard. Low distortion analog audio controls. High voltage DC power supply for greater dynamic range. 8v output capability. 2-channel RCA auxiliary inputs. 4 channel RCA line high level outputs. Security code system. Cellular phone audio mute. Bass and treble controls. 4-way balance control. Digital quartz clock. TUNER: FM diversity. Audio store. Electronic quartz-locked PLL tuning. Presets for 6 AM and 18 FM. Signal actuated stereo control. CD TRANSPORT: Full logic CD controls. Track repeat. Last position memory. Track music search. Fiber optic digital output. CHANGER CONTROL: Direct disc select. 6-18 disc control capability. Size 2"H, 7"W and 6-5/16"D. Sold from . Last retail price $2000.00
